Trading is often viewed as a combination of skill and chance. While occasional lucky trades may yield short-term gains, many believe consistency plays a more critical role in achieving sustainable success. Here are a few perspectives to consider:
1. Reducing Emotional Decision-Making
Consistency in trading often involves sticking to a well-thought-out plan. By relying on predefined strategies, traders might minimize emotional decisions that could lead to impulsive actions. This could include adhering to risk management principles and avoiding the temptation to chase sudden market movements.
2. Building a Reliable Process
Luck is unpredictable, but a consistent trading process can provide structure. Over time, traders who refine their approach, test strategies, and adjust based on results may see more dependable outcomes.
3. Managing Risks Effectively
Luck might lead to big wins occasionally, but consistent traders often focus on managing risks. Using tools like stop-loss orders and proper position sizing can help preserve capital over the long term.
4. Understanding Market Patterns
Traders who commit to consistency tend to study market behavior and recognize patterns over time. This might help them make informed decisions rather than relying on chance.
5. Emphasizing Long-Term Goals
Short-term gains may be influenced by luck, but consistency often aligns with achieving long-term objectives. Traders who focus on steady growth and continuous learning might find more success than those chasing quick wins.

By prioritizing consistency over luck, traders might develop a more structured and disciplined approach. While luck may play a role in isolated scenarios, many agree that a consistent process can help traders navigate the markets more effectively. Flexibility and learning are also important as markets evolve over time.
